Railways’ Revenue Earnings up by 12.53 Percent During April to August 2014

The total approximate earnings of Indian Railways on originating basis during 1st April 2014 to 31st August 2014 were Rs. 61324.64 crore compared to Rs. 54496.73 crore during the same period last year, registering an increase of 12.53 per cent. 

The total approximate earnings from goods during 1st April 2014 – 31st August 2014 were Rs. 40879.09 core compared to Rs. 37103.34 crore during the same period last year, registering an increase of 10.18 per cent. 

The total approximate revenue earnings from passengers during 1st April 2014 – 31st August 2014 were Rs. 17700.16 crore compared to Rs. 14758.01 crore during the same period last year, registering an increase of 19.94 percent. 

The approximate revenue earnings from other coaching amounted to Rs.1649.40 crore during April 2014 – August 2014 compared to Rs. 1560.66 crore during the same period last year, registering an increase of 5.69 per cent. 

The total approximate numbers of passengers booked during 1st April 2014 – 31st August 2014 were 3508.68 million compared to 3467.60 million during the same period last year, showing an increase of 1.18 per cent. In the suburban and non-suburban sectors, the numbers of passengers booked during April 2014 – August 2014 were 1932.83 million and 1575.85 million compared to 1882.25 million and 1585.35 million registering an increase of 2.69 per cent and a decrease of 0.60 per cent respectively during the same period last year.
